Google cloud platform 在区域之间移动Google云计算实例

Google cloud platform 在区域之间移动Google云计算实例,google-cloud-platform,google-compute-engine,uefi,Google Cloud Platform,Google Compute Engine,Uefi,我在zone europe-west3-c的谷歌云上有一个计算引擎实例。在过去几天中,当我尝试启动它时,我收到以下消息: “项目/项目/区域/欧洲西部3-c”区域没有足够的可用资源来满足请求。请尝试其他区域,或稍后再试 由于几天来我一直在尝试连接,所以我决定在区域之间移动实例。我尝试使用此API: 但我得到了这个错误: 404:资源使用无效:“实例是启用UEFI的实例,不支持MoveInstance。” 我真的需要我的工作,所以任何快速的帮助将非常感谢这个计算实例 使用以下gcloud命令,您可

我在zone europe-west3-c的谷歌云上有一个计算引擎实例。在过去几天中,当我尝试启动它时,我收到以下消息:

“项目/项目/区域/欧洲西部3-c”区域没有足够的可用资源来满足请求。请尝试其他区域,或稍后再试

由于几天来我一直在尝试连接,所以我决定在区域之间移动实例。我尝试使用此API:

但我得到了这个错误:

404:资源使用无效:“实例是启用UEFI的实例,不支持MoveInstance。”


我真的需要我的工作,所以任何快速的帮助将非常感谢这个计算实例

使用以下gcloud命令,您可以。但是,如果可能,可以使用moveInstances API来节省一些工作,但是在某些情况下,可以选择使用moveInstances API

gcloud compute instances move example-instance-1 --zone us-central1-b --destination-zone us-central1-f
尽可能使用moveInstance API自动移动实例,该API为您处理移动实例的所有步骤。但是,如果不能使用API,则可以执行以下操作

您可以从实例磁盘创建或快照,然后从映像创建或快照。您可以在任何区域/区域中创建新VM

另一种方法是使用以下gcloud命令启动VM磁盘:

gcloud compute instances detach-disk Instance-Name --disk=Disk-Name --zone Disk-zone

现在,如果您进入计算引擎>磁盘>单击虚拟机磁盘的名称>管理磁盘>创建实例;创建新实例您可以将VM实例更改或移动到您选择的区域。

通过分离磁盘来移动实例对我来说很有用!但是,您确实需要按精确的顺序进行操作:(1)拆下磁盘;(2) 将分离的磁盘移动到新区域;(3) 使用刚移动的磁盘在新区域中创建新实例。